Celebrate the arrival of Spring through pressed flower exploration at Yoga Together!

This pressed flower workshop will introduce participants to the art & science of preserving botanical elements through flattening & drying techniques. Attendees will learn different pressing methods, explore composition strategies & leave with a framed pressed flower design reflecting growth. Each is mounted on handmade paper.

The guided workshop embraces the symbolism of balance & renewal associated with an Equinox, allowing participants to foster community & connect with the changing seasons in a creative way.
